Electrochemical CO2 Reduction Using Copper–Zinc and Copper–Bismuth Catalysts: Mechanistic Insights and Design Perspectives

open access: yesThe Chemical Record, Volume 25, Issue 12, December 2025.
This review explores tandem copper‐based catalysts combining Cu–Bi and Cu–Zn interfaces for CO2 electroreduction. Synergistic effects guide product selectivity: Cu–Bi promotes formate formation, while Cu–Zn enhances *CO generation for C2 product pathways.

Introducing Glaciohydrological Model Calibration Using Sentinel‐1 SAR Wet Snow Maps in the Himalaya‐Karakoram

open access: yesWater Resources Research, Volume 61, Issue 12, December 2025.
Abstract Field‐based studies are limited in Himalaya‐Karakoram (HK); therefore, remote sensing and glaciohydrological modeling provide alternative solutions to investigate runoff evolution under changing climate conditions. Due to limited in situ runoff data in HK, glaciohydrological models are often calibrated using high‐resolution remote sensing data.

Preparation and Characterization Polypyrrole/Humic Acid Composite Electrode for Metal ion Extraction

open access: yesInternational Journal of Electrochemical Science, 2011
Redox and acid base properties of soil humic substances were studied. Phenolic groups predominated over the carboxylic groups. The oxidation capacity of humic acids (HA) show values from 1.7 and 2.2 molc kg-1 at pH 7.0 and pH 9.0, respectively.
